JOB SUMMARY:

As a Dock Worker, your primary responsibility is to facilitate the efficient loading and unloading of freight at the trucking terminal. You will play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th flow of goods between transportation vehicles and the terminal, contributing to the overall logistics and supply chain operations. Maintain a clean and safe work environment for the worker as well as those they work around and wear appropriate PPE required for the job.


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BLITIES:


  • Safely and efficiently load and unload freight from trucks and other transportation vehicles using forklifts, pallet jacks, and other relevant equipment.

  • Organize and sort incoming and outgoing freight based on destination, shipping method, and other relevant criteria to streamline the dispatch and delivery process.

  • Accurately record and maintain documentation related to shipments, ensuring that all relevant information such as quantity, weight, and destination are correctly documented.

  • Adhere to all safety protocols and guidelines during loading, unloading, and handling of freight. Report any safety hazards or incidents immediately.

  • Operate material handling equipment, including forklifts and pallet jacks, in a safe and efficient manner. Conduct routine checks and maintenance on equipment as required.

  • Collaborate with truck drivers, warehouse staff, and other team members to coordinate the timely and accurate movement of freight. Communicate effectively with supervisors and colleagues.

  • Inspect incoming and outgoing freight for damage, discrepancies, or defects. Report any issues to the appropriate personnel and follow established procedures for handling damaged or incorrect shipments.

  • Assist in maintaining accurate inventory records by verifying stock levels, conducting cycle counts, and participating in periodic inventory audits.

  • Work collaboratively with terminal staff to ensure the overall efficiency of terminal operations. Provide support to other areas of the terminal as needed.

  • Other duties as assigned.
